Topic: Allegedly this is how many people becomes police officers in South Africa while they don't qualify.
Now as we are talking, there are thousands and thousands of people, whom are admitted in police colleges around the republic of South Africa. This is following the South African Police Service recruitment which was conducted few months ago.
Even though things are like that, there have been other people complaining that they don't get a call up even though they pass all activities or rather assessments which are required.
Some rumors even said that, sometimes people who didn't even do assessments do get call up.
After some investigation, the ENCA had reported that the applicants allegedly bribe officers more especially on the HRM Division to get to the police college and becomes police officers.
Maybe this is the reason why the republic of South Africa do have many police officers who don't even know their jobs.
